Abstract
This invention discloses molecular markers closely linked to the major QTL locus qSL2V of *Triticum aestivum* ear length and their applications. This invention locates a novel major QTL for ear length, named qSL2V, from the artificially synthesized durum wheat-*Triticum aestivum* didiploid STH65-4, and provides molecular markers I-M5 and I-M3 for identifying this locus. This invention can be used for marker-assisted selection breeding of the ear length QTL locus qSL2V, providing molecular tools for identifying or assisting in the identification of *Triticum aestivum* ear length genes for transfer and utilization, thus accelerating the creation of wheat germplasm resources and the process of high-yield breeding.
